Description
A comprehensive guide to get you up to speed with the latest developments of practical machine learning with Python and upgrade your understanding of machine learning (ML) algorithms and techniques
Key Features
Dive into machine learning algorithms to solve the complex challenges faced by data scientists today
Explore cutting edge content reflecting deep learning and reinforcement learning developments
Use updated Python libraries such as TensorFlow, PyTorch, and scikit-learn to track machine learning projects end-to-end
Book DescriptionPython Machine Learning By Example, Third Edition serves as a comprehensive gateway into the world of machine learning (ML).
With six new chapters, on topics including movie recommendation engine development with Naive Bayes, recognizing faces with support vector machine, predicting stock prices with artificial neural networks, categorizing images of clothing with convolutional neural networks, predicting with sequences using recurring neural networks, and leveraging reinforcement learning for making decisions, the book has been considerably updated for the latest enterprise requirements.
At the same time, this book provides actionable insights on the key fundamentals of ML with Python programming. Hayden applies his expertise to demonstrate implementations of algorithms in Python, both from scratch and with libraries.
Each chapter walks through an industry-adopted application. With the help of realistic examples, you will gain an understanding of the mechanics of ML techniques in areas such as exploratory data analysis, feature engineering, classification, regression, clustering, and NLP.
By the end of this ML Python book, you will have gained a broad picture of the ML ecosystem and will be well-versed in the best practices of applying ML techniques to solve problems.What you will learn
Understand the important concepts in ML and data science
Use Python to explore the world of data mining and analytics
Scale up model training using varied data complexities with Apache Spark
Delve deep into text analysis and NLP using Python libraries such NLTK and Gensim
Select and build an ML model and evaluate and optimize its performance
Implement ML algorithms from scratch in Python, TensorFlow 2, PyTorch, and scikit-learn
Who this book is forIf you're a machine learning enthusiast, data analyst, or data engineer highly passionate about machine learning and want to begin working on machine learning assignments, this book is for you.
Prior knowledge of Python coding is assumed and basic familiarity with statistical concepts will be beneficial, although this is not necessary.

Person
Yuxi (Hayden) Liu was a Machine Learning Software Engineer at Google. With a wealth of experience from his tenure as a machine learning scientist, he has applied his expertise across data-driven domains and applied his ML expertise in computational advertising, cybersecurity, and information retrieval.
He is the author of a series of influential machine learning books and an education enthusiast. His debut book, also the first edition of Python Machine Learning by Example, ranked the #1 bestseller in Amazon and has been translated into many different languages.
